The Plot

21 Bridges follows an NYPD detective named Andre Davis as he investigates a drug cartel that is responsible for a series of murders. After uncovering a massive conspiracy, he decides to shut down all Manhattan bridges to track down and capture the suspects. The film is rated R for its graphic violence, language, and drug use.

Violence and Gore

The movie is full of intense, graphic violence. There are numerous shootouts where people are shot and killed. Blood and gore are also present in several scenes, particularly during an autopsy. The film also features a character who is burned alive, which could be disturbing for younger viewers.

Sexual Content

There is no sexual content in 21 Bridges. There is some mild flirting between characters, but nothing explicit whatsoever.

Language

The movie features frequent use of strong language. There are plenty of F-bombs throughout the film, along with other profanities.

Drug and Alcohol Use

The film is centered around a drug cartel, so drug use is prevalent throughout. Characters are shown snorting cocaine and smoking marijuana. Alcohol is also present in several scenes.

Themes

The underlying themes of 21 Bridges include corruption, justice, and revenge. These are heavy themes that may be difficult for younger viewers to fully comprehend.

Comparing to Other Movies

Compared to other films in the action/crime genre, 21 Bridges is moderately graphic. It is not as violent or gory as films like John Wick, but it is not suitable for young children.

  1. What is 21 Bridges and is it appropriate for kids?
  2. 21 Bridges is a crime thriller movie about a police detective who shuts down Manhattan's 21 bridges to find two cop killers. The movie is rated R for violence, language, and some drug use. It is not appropriate for children under 17.

  3. Why is 21 Bridges rated R?
  4. 21 Bridges is rated R for violence, language, and some drug use. The movie contains intense action scenes, gun violence, and graphic images of dead bodies. Additionally, there is frequent use of strong language and some characters use drugs.

  5. Is 21 Bridges suitable for teenagers?
  6. While the movie is rated R and not suitable for children under 17, teenagers may be able to handle the intense action and violence. Parents should use their discretion and decide if their teenagers are mature enough to watch this movie.

  7. What are some of the themes in 21 Bridges?
  8. Some of the themes in 21 Bridges include justice, revenge, loyalty, and corruption. The movie explores the complexities of the criminal justice system and the toll that violence takes on both the victims and the perpetrators.
